On the front panel for the 480, the 4th button from the left adjusts the
step size for the selector click knob.
I found that if I press it once and touch the tuning knob, all of a sudden I
have a nice slow tuning dial. I had the internal menu set to 250, and this
combination was amazingly slow. I pushed the internal menu 3 up to 1000,
and now I have a very nice tuning ratio. Press the button for a low beep
and I can tune fast across a chunk of spectrum.
Just tap the button rather than hold it in.
